Raipur: The Central Government has entrusted a highly significant responsibility to Dr. Ravi Mittal, a 2016-batch IAS officer of the Chhattisgarh cadre. He has been appointed as a Deputy Secretary in the Prime Minister’s Office (PMO) on deputation.
It is worth mentioning that Dr. Ravi Mittal has cultivated a reputation as a highly composed and grassroots-oriented officer. He completed his MBBS studies at the prestigious Maulana Azad Medical College (MAMC) in Delhi. Leaving the medical profession behind, he chose the path of the Civil Services to dedicate himself to the service of the nation.
He was previously posted as the Collector of Jashpur. Dr. Mittal has also served as the Chief Executive Officer (CEO) of the District Panchayats in Mahasamund, Raigarh, and Raipur. Additionally, he served as the Sub-Divisional Magistrate (SDM) of Bagicha in 2018.
Prior to his move to Delhi, Dr. Ravi Mittal held the position of Commissioner Chhattisgarh Public Relations. He also served as the CEO of ‘Chhattisgarh Samvad’ and worked as a Joint Secretary in the Chhattisgarh Chief Minister’s Office (CMO).
